Wheels, Inc. will celebrate its 75th anniversary next year. Zollie Frank and Armund Schoen founded the venerable company in 1939 and in doing so, created the fleet leasing industry. When we asked Scott Pattullo, Senior Vice President of Sales, Marketing & Account Management, to tell us what makes Wheels successful today, he said, "To me, it is about the consistency of the values. It is about the customer service values; about understanding that we are a service company and we only get to survive if we serve our clients well, if we treat them well, if we bring value to them, if we serve them however they want to be served."
Remarketing has been changing for the car rental industry in recent years – with less volume going through auctions and more emphasis on upstreaming. Automakers are keeping fleet sales limited, too.
That’s improving conditions for used vehicle prices.
Avis Budget Group is showing significant signs of how car rental companies have been rethinking their role in the world of used vehicle remarketing.
During a third quarter call, executives explained how the car rental company “cascades” cars between its Avis, Budget, Payless, and Zipcar brands for maximum usage.
About half the cars go to auctions, and the other half go directly to dealers and consumers.
